The Sex Issue: Sapphic Edition. We’re centering lust, intimacy, and the messy edges of desire. Submit with this theme in mind. You are also welcome to pitch us something so bold.

We Accept

Essays, op-eds, and experimental writing (1,000 words max)

Poetry (up to 3 poems per submission)

Visual art, illustration, and photography (hi-res JPG/PNG, max 10MB per file)

Community recs: tell us about queer-owned spaces, events, and creatives we should feature

How to Submit

Use the form below to upload your work

File types: .docx, .pdf, .jpg, .png

Please include a short bio (2–3 sentences)

Optional: add an artist’s statement or context if needed

What We’re About

We don’t censor queer sexuality, identity, or politics. Work that is racist, transphobic, homophobic, ableist, or otherwise harmful will be trashed immediately.

Rights + Publishing

By submitting, you allow us to feature your work in Sapphique Magazine (digital and/or print) and on our social platforms. You retain all rights to your work — we just ask for the honor of publishing it first.
